Fine for GDPR Infringement
The National Supervisory Authority for Personal Data Processing completed an investigation in April 2026 into the data controller BLUE PROJECTS S.R.L. and found infringements of Article 32(1)(b) and (d), as well as Article 32(2), of Regulation (EU) 2016/679.
Accordingly, the controller was fined 12,734 lei, equivalent to 2,500 euros.
The investigation was initiated following the submission by BLUE PROJECTS S.R.L. of a personal data breach notification pursuant to Article 33 of Regulation (EU) 2016/679.
During the investigation, it was established that a cyberattack targeting the controller’s IT infrastructure compromised the confidentiality and availability of the personal data stored within its systems. This resulted in unauthorized access to the personal data of a significant number of data subjects, including employees, contractors, and individuals involved in correspondence. The affected personal data included: first and last names, personal identification numbers (CNP), residential addresses, contact details, email addresses, job titles and curriculum vitae (CVs).
The investigation concluded that the controller had failed to implement appropriate technical and organizational measures to ensure a level of security appropriate to the risk posed by the processing activities. These measures should have included, among other things, the capability to ensure the ongoing confidentiality of processing systems and services, as well as the implementation of a process for regularly testing, assessing, and evaluating the effectiveness of the technical and organizational measures in place to ensure the security of processing.
Furthermore, pursuant to Article 58(2)(d) of the Regulation, the supervisory authority imposed a corrective measure requiring the controller to implement, at both the technical and procedural levels, a system for monitoring data flows throughout the organization’s operations.
